As Drought Sets In, Communities Hope SGMA can Change the Future of Water

About 26,800 residents in the San Joaquin Valley rely on domestic wells or very small water systems for drinking water. But these shallow groundwater wells are threatened by overpumping and drought.
SB403 would authorize CA State Water Board to consolidate water systems at risk of failure

Current law does not allow the State Water Board to act proactively to prevent water systems from failing.
